Used to be excellent when they sold local milk but now it’s mostly Cornish milk. Nothing against Cornish milk but constantly disappointing that they do not stock their own local IoW Milk.

Self service 24 hours pay by cash or card. Milk plus eggs, potatoes, cream, jams etc. A quirky convenient "shed shop" on the edge of Havenstreet. Easy parking.

Love this place. Such a great idea and supporting an Island business is always good. I only went in for 1 milkshake but left with the 2 Flavour of the months (Black Cherry & Cream Egg) both were amazing I'll be heading back for more. I love the fact that it's all glass bottles you can recycle and use over and over again, no more plastic milk cartons.

Great idea to sell farm supplies in a self help Honesty shop. We made the extra journey during our 2 week stay to support the farm as much as possible. Lovely milk, butter, jams and other goodies.
